Tomeka Johnson is a License Clinical Social Worker Associate. She received a Master of Social Work Degree from Fayetteville State University. Tomeka is passionate about healing and restoration. She offers tools that allow clients to regain their life, identity and power so that they can live a self-sufficient and empowering life within their community. She is ethical and approaches used are evidence based.

Tomeka believes in Culturally Appropriate Interventions strategies for clients of different cultures. The approaches and technique used are culturally sensitive. She has several years of experience working with Hispanic and Indigenous families.

 She strives to make sure her sessions are creative, engaging and effective. Lastly, she wants to develop a strong therapeutic alliance with her clients and provide a non-judgmental environment for healing to transpire.

During and after graduation, she worked in various mental health settings. She worked as a school social worker, a psychotherapist from a county hospital, several community mental health agencies, and a treatment facility that served clients suffering with addictions, trauma, and sexual abuse. She spent most of her time working with Children, Adolescences, Teens and Families. She encourages her clients to pursue a holist approach to health, incorporating exercise, proper sleep, and nutrition and activities they enjoy.

 

Specialties:  Family Therapy, Conflict Resolution Therapy for Families; Individual therapy for Adults and Children; Spiritual Therapy; Play therapy for Children; Mindfulness: Psychotherapy for Families, Children, Schizophrenia, Bipolar, Mood Disorders and Psychotic Disorders: CBT for Depression, Anxiety, and Addictions.
